Getting from Hong Kong International Airport (HKG) to central Hong Kong
The address for HKG is 1 Cheong Hong Rd.
From Hong Kong International Airport, Hong Kong is approximately 20 miles away. It takes around 30 minutes to get to the centre driving.
It takes around 45 minutes if you're travelling on public transport.
When to fly to Hong Kong International Airport (HKG)
It's time to choose your travel dates for your flight from Humberside Airport to Hong Kong International Airport. April is the most popular month to head to Hong Kong. If you like a more low-key vibe, go in April.
When reserving your flight from Humberside Airport to Hong Kong International Airport, think about the kind of weather you enjoy. August is the warmest month in Hong Kong, with temperatures ranging from 26ºC (79ºF) to 32ºC (90ºF).
If you want cooler conditions, look for a cheap ticket from HUY to HKG in January. Average temperatures are between 11ºC (52ºF) and 20ºC (68ºF) then.
Explore more of China
Guangzhou is just one of the many cities in China waiting to be discovered once you've taken in the sights of Hong Kong. Around 80 miles away to the north-west, check out popular attractions including Canton Tower, Yuexiu Park and Chen Clan Ancestral Hall.
Around 17 miles north-west of Hong Kong, Shenzhen is another essential stop in China. No visit is complete without checking out Window of the World, Dafen Oil Painting Village and Shenzhen Museum of Contemporary Art and Urban Planning.
